This is something what is also lost here in the forum, but it's already in the CAR 6.1 and CAR 6.2:

Questions by Scott and Answers by Christian H. - at the HiG-Chat:
Quote
Scott, 10.07.2012 16:34:
Greetings to everybody here. This morning at CarcassonneCentral.com was published the long-awaited sixth edition of the Complete Annotated Rules for Carcassonne. Our new editor, Christopher Ober, has added some color-coded footnotes, of which the red ones indicate questions that have been raised in our community but no official answer has been sought, so I think now it's time to take care of that.

If a player has a follower and a builder on a road and then extends the road with a bridge, does that trigger the builder's double-turn or is that only when the road is extended by a tile?
Quote
Scott, 10.07.2012 16:39:
At the end of the game when the score for the King is being calculated, are castles included in the tally of the number of completed cities? (I suspect not, but somebody asked.)
Quote
Scott, 10.07.2012 16:46:
Can followers in the castle quarter of the City of Carcassonne (Count expansion) be moved to a castle (Bridges, Castles & Bazaars expansion)?

Quote
Christian H., 10.07.2012 23:58:
Hi Scott,

I'll answer your questions:

1) A castle isn't a city. It is a new area. So it doesn't count for the City of Carcassonne (town-quarter Castle) and not for the King-Tile.

2) The Builder-Turn will be triggered by increasing the Area. This means by a tile, by the bridge, by placing the tunnel-marker. The Dragon eats the Meeples on the Bridge, too.
There isn't a difference between a wooden bridge placed by a player and a printed bridge like at the following tiles (see Link "Plaettchenliste" in the Infobox above on this site): TA (bridge over city), HB (bridge over road), GFluss4 and GFluss5. Bridges are handled as roads.
